Franco-Nevada Corporation (NYSE:FNV - Get Free Report) TSE: FNV's stock price reached a new 52-week high during trading on Friday . The company traded as high as $206.64 and last traded at $207.73, with a volume of 117706 shares trading hands. The stock had previously closed at $202.50.

Franco-Nevada Stock Up 2.5%

The firm has a market capitalization of $40.00 billion, a P/E ratio of 50.93,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.64 and a beta of 0.41. The company's 50 day moving average is $177.28 and its 200-day moving average is $167.25.

Franco-Nevada (NYSE:FNV - Get Free Report) TSE: FNV last issued its earnings results on Monday, August 11th. The basic materials company reported $1.24 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.10 by $0.14. The business had revenue of $369.40 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$382.70 million. Franco-Nevada had a net margin of 58.82% and a return on equity of 12.56%. Franco-Nevada's revenue was up 42.0%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the prior year, the firm earned $0.75 earnings per share. On average, analysts predict that Franco-Nevada Corporation will post 3.09 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Franco-Nevada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, September 25th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, September 11th will be issued a dividend of $0.38 per share.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, September 11th. This represents a $1.52 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.7%. Franco-Nevada's dividend payout ratio is presently 37.35%.

About Franco-Nevada

(Get Free Report)

Franco-Nevada Corporation operates as a gold-focused royalty and streaming company in South America, Central America, Mexico, the United States, Canada, and internationally. It operates through Mining and Energy segments. The company manages its portfolio with a focus on precious metals, such as gold, silver, and platinum group metals; and engages in the sale of crude oil, natural gas, and natural gas liquids through a third-party marketing agent.
